解决Oracle错误1053: 连接拒绝(oracle错误1053)

Oracle 错误1053指的是连接拒绝,主要的原因是服务器上的Oracle实例没有正确的设置,或者Oracle服务器上没有正确的配置,从而导致客户端无法正确连接到Oracle数据库服务器上。如果你在使用Oracle服务器时遇到了这个错误,应该如何解决?下面我们就来一起看看吧。

首先,检查Oracle实例上的服务重新启动。一定确保在Oracle实例上设置了正确的端口号和混合模式,并且端口号必须是空闲的,以免发生冲突。例如,Oracle默认使用的是1521端口,可以使用以下命令来查看端口的状态:

netstat -aon | grep 1521

如果你发现端口1521已经被其他应用占用,可以使用修改Oracle服务中混合模式的端口号为一个空闲的端口号。

其次,如果端口号没有被其他应用占用,你应该检查一下,看看服务器上是否有Oracle客户端安装,如果没有,可以尝试安装一下,以诊断问题。

除此之外,如果你正在使用Windows系统,你还可以查看一下Windows服务,看看Oracle进程是否正在运行。你可以使用下面的命令来查看进程:

Tasklist | find “oracle” 

如果没有Oracle进程运行,你可以使用一下命令启动Oracle服务:

Net start OracleServiceORCL 

最后,如果以上方法仍然没有能够解决Oracle错误1053的问题,你可以尝试使用tnsnames.ora对Oracle进行重新配置,以及检查sqlnet.ora是否配置正确。

总之,Oracle错误1053是由于Oracle实例、服务器、端口号或者客户端设置上出现了问题而导致的。必须根据实际情况,仔细检查和排查,再施行对应的解决方案才能够有效解决这个错误。


数据运维技术 » 解决Oracle错误1053: 连接拒绝(oracle错误1053)